Here Comes Santa Claus

The 'real' Saint Nicholas was a 4th century Bishop of Myra associated with many miraculous events of varying historical attestability. My favourite of these for sheer exuberant oddness has to be the one about the three young boys, murdered by a butcher during a time of famine, chopped up ( chopped up! ) and pickled in brine for seven years ( seven years! ) before being miraculously restored in answer to the bishop's intercessory prayers. A  16th century French song  on the St. Nicholas Centre  website tells the tale in the good old bluntly gruesome way of good old-fashioned folk rhyme.
